What Are Sleep Trackers?

Sleep trackers are devices or apps. They monitor your sleep cycles. These tools collect data on sleep duration and quality. They often include features like heart rate monitoring. Some track oxygen levels and movement during sleep.

Types Of Sleep Trackers

There are different types of sleep trackers available. Each has unique features and benefits.

TypeDescriptionExample Devices
Wearable TrackersThese are worn on the wrist. They monitor sleep through sensors.Fitbit, Garmin
Non-Wearable TrackersThese are placed under the mattress. They track sleep without being worn.Withings Sleep, Beddit
Smartphone AppsApps use phone sensors and microphones. They track sleep patterns.Sleep Cycle, Pillow

Each type of sleep tracker has its pros and cons. Choose one that fits your needs best.

Wearable Devices

Wearable devices are popular for tracking sleep. They are easy to use and offer many features. Here are some top wearable sleep trackers:

  • Fitbit Charge 6 – Tracks sleep stages and heart rate. Offers a silent alarm feature and stress management tools.
  • Apple Watch Series 9 – Monitors sleep patterns, blood oxygen levels, and temperature. Integrates well with iPhone.
  • Garmin Vivosmart 5 – Tracks REM sleep and offers a body battery feature. Light and comfortable to wear.
  • Oura Ring Gen 3 Horizon – A smart ring that tracks sleep stages, HRV, and body temperature. Offers readiness and sleep scores.
  • Samsung Galaxy Watch6 – Provides sleep coaching, SpO₂ monitoring, and snore detection. Stylish and functional.

Non-wearable Options

Non-wearable sleep trackers are also effective. They provide accurate data without needing to be worn. Below are the best non-wearable sleep trackers:

  • Withings Sleep Analyzer – Placed under the mattress. Tracks sleep cycles, snoring, and breathing disturbances.
  • SleepScore Max – Uses sonar technology to track sleep. Provides insights and personalized advice.
  • Beddit 3.5 Sleep Monitor – A thin strip placed on the bed. Tracks sleep stages and breathing. Syncs with Apple Health.
  • Emfit QS+ Active – Under-mattress sensor. Monitors HRV, recovery, and detailed sleep stages.
  • Google Nest Hub (2nd Gen) – Uses radar technology for motion tracking. Detects snoring and coughing.

Optimizing Sleep Environment

Creating an optimal sleep environment can significantly enhance sleep quality. Here are some tips:

  • Use blackout curtains to keep the room dark.
  • Maintain a cool room temperature, around 65°F.
  • Use earplugs or white noise machines to block out noise.
  • Invest in a comfortable mattress and pillows.

Consider these adjustments to improve your sleep environment:

  1. Limit screen time before bed to reduce blue light exposure.
  2. Establish a relaxing pre-sleep routine, such as reading or meditating.
  3. Avoid caffeine and heavy meals close to bedtime.
